As we previously reported, Sichuan Yahua Industrial Group made an announcement at the end of December that its subsidiary, Yahua Lithium, signed a 5-year lithium supply agreement with Tesla. The contract’s value is reported to be a range of $630-880 million. Yahual Lithium will provide battery-grade lithium hydroxide to Tesla from 2021 through 2025. We’ve written at length about the vast need for lithium if the electric vehicle market is going to keep growing at the pace it’s been growing at. Lithium is abundant on Earth, but it takes years to set up lithium mines and manufacturing facilities to get that lithium ready for use in a battery, so it’s not a resource issue, but rather a business and investment issue.

China is charging full speed ahead into electric vehicles, on track to sell over 2 million electric vehicles this year, from 1.1 million in 2018. The rapid growth has been driven partly by policy, but increasingly by consumer demand.
